You've got a good clean layout here. It communicates it's information well. The margins are well done and give all of your layout objects room to breathe. I like your color choices as well. They echo the colors in your image and help tie your layout in with it. Color is also used well here to establish a visual hierarchy. I can, at a glance, tell what you feel is important in your content. I like the font choice as well. Your sans-serif makes for good bodycopy and your rounded serif type works well on your navigation.

Overall, the design seems to lack visual interest, though. I think it needs a background pattern or image that would help offset the clean layout. I think your included image would work well for that purpose. Perhaps if the site had been laid out around a full size version of that image. Also, I don't care for the variable size of your button text. Size all your buttons around the longest one. I think using your navigation font in your headline would have helped a bit in the visual ineterest department.
